Understanding Backlinks and Their Importance

Before we delve into the relationship between social media and backlinks, it’s vital to understand what backlinks are and why they matter.

What are Backlinks?

Backlinks, also known as inbound links or incoming links, are hyperlinks from one webpage to another. They are crucial for search engine optimization (SEO) since they signal to search engines that your content is valuable and worth linking to. Websites that gain more backlinks from reputable sources tend to rank higher in search engine results pages (SERPs).

Why are Backlinks Important?

  • SEO Ranking Factors: Search engines like Google use backlinks as a key factor in determining a website’s authority and relevance.
  • Referral Traffic: Backlinks can also drive referral traffic, bringing users directly to your site when they click on the link.
  • Brand Authority and Visibility: High-quality backlinks from reputable sources can enhance your brand’s authority and online visibility.

Strategies for Leveraging Social Media for Backlinking

To effectively leverage social media for backlinking, consider the following strategies:

1. Create High-Quality Content

Infographics and Visual Content

Visual content such as infographics often performs exceptionally well on social media due to its shareability. Crafting compelling infographics can draw attention, increasing the chances of being linked back to by bloggers and website owners who find it useful.

Long-Form Articles

Publishing in-depth, well-researched articles can make you an authority in your niche. Sharing such content on social media invites discussions and shares, increasing the chances of it being linked.

2. Share Consistently and Strategically

Timing and Frequency

Timing can make a significant difference in your social media strategy. Use analytics to determine when your audience is most active, and schedule your posts to align with these peaks.

Content Variety

Diverse content types—videos, articles, polls, and images—can appeal to different segments of your audience. Keep your content engaging to encourage shares and, subsequently, backlinks.

3. Engage with Your Audience

Respond to Comments

When users interact with your posts, respond to their comments and encourage further discussion. Engagement can lead to higher visibility and potentially more links.

Encourage User-Generated Content

Soliciting your audience to create content related to your brand can yield backlinks as they will likely link back to your original content that inspired them.

4. Use Social Media Groups and Forums

Participate in Niche Groups

Join social media groups related to your niche where you can share valuable insights and links to your content. Always make sure to follow community guidelines to avoid being considered spammy.

Engage in Relevant Discussions

Participating in relevant discussions on platforms like Reddit or LinkedIn can open up opportunities to share valuable content and create backlinks.

5. Collaborate with Influencers

Identify Key Influencers

Identify influential figures in your industry and engage with them. Consider reaching out for collaborations that will create content together, consequently leading to shareable resources.

Guest Posts and Interviews

Offer to contribute guest posts for their blogs or conduct interviews with them. This can help you tap into their audience and generate quality backlinks.

6. Use Social Media Ads

Paid promotion can increase the reach of your content significantly, and while it doesn’t guarantee backlinks, increased visibility often leads to organic shares and links.

7. Leverage Hashtags and Trends

Use Relevant Hashtags

Utilizing trending and relevant hashtags can enhance the visibility of your content on social media, attracting more users and potential backlinks.

Participate in Trending Topics

Engaging in trending conversations or challenges can draw attention to your account, providing opportunities for backlinks from those discussing the trend.

Tools and Resources for Backlinking via Social Media

Utilizing specific tools can enhance your social media backlinking strategy significantly. Here are a few recommendations:

1. Social Media Management Tools

Tools like Buffer and Hootsuite enable you to schedule posts, analyze engagement metrics, and optimize your social media strategy.

2. Analytics Tools

Google Analytics and social media analytics tools can help you track the traffic generated from social media and understand which posts are driving backlinks.

3. Backlink Analysis Tools

Tools like Ahrefs or SEMrush allow you to monitor your backlinks and examine your competitors’ backlink strategies, providing insights for your efforts.

Measuring the Effectiveness of Your Social Media Backlinking Strategy

Tracking the effectiveness of your social media efforts is essential for adjusting your strategy. Here are key metrics to focus on:

1. Traffic from Social Media

Monitor the traffic directed to your site from social media platforms, focusing on how it correlates with your backlink generation efforts.

2. Engagement Rates

Measure shares, likes, and comments on your posts to assess how well your content resonates with your audience.

3. Backlink Growth

Regularly check the number of backlinks your content is receiving. Analyze which types of content are attracting the most links.

4. Domain Authority

Keep an eye on your domain authority, as increased backlinks from reputable sites can contribute to higher authority scores.
